Academic Support Center
The Academic Support Center provides learning and study skills resources for all students who wish to enhance their academic abilities to better meet the standards of the university as well as their own educational goals. The center works to strengthen students' responsibility and accountability for their own learning and serves as a resource for the faculty and staff of the TLU community. Students of all abilities, including successful students who want to polish their academic skills and students who are struggling, are welcome to use the center's services. All services are available to registered TLU students.
The center provides
Peer Tutoring in many subjects,
Supplemental Instruction (SI) in certain courses and study skills workshops at various times. The center also provides walk-in assistance as well as appointments for individual students who may want further academic assistance.
Individual ConferencesCenter staff is available to confer with individual students about particular difficulties, such as low motivation, inability to concentrate, poor study skills, lack of time management skills or any other academic concerns. After initial assessments, staff will work with the student to develop a plan to address the problem and improve the student’s success in the classroom.
